Trusted WordPress tutorials, when you need them most.
Beginner’s Guide to WordPress
Coupe WPB
25 Million+
Websites using our plugins
16+
Years of WordPress experience
3000+
WordPress tutorials
by experts

Qu'est-ce que c'est : Tableau

Dans les langages de programmation informatique, un tableau est une variable spéciale qui contient plusieurs valeurs sous un même nom. Vous pouvez accéder à ces différentes valeurs en vous référant à un numéro d’index ou à une clé de texte.

Dans WordPress, les tableaux ont de nombreuses utilisations. Ils stockent les options de configuration du thème comme les couleurs, les polices et les mises en page ; les données des publications comme le titre, le contenu et la catégorie ; les informations sur les utilisateurs comme les données de profil et les rôles, et bien d’autres choses encore.

Vous avez peut-être aussi remarqué que beaucoup de nos tutoriels contenant des extraits de code utilisent des tableaux.

Glossary: Array

Description technique de la fonction PHP array()

WordPress est écrit dans le langage de programmation PHP. Si vous souhaitez en savoir plus sur l’utilisation du code dans WordPress, vous trouverez peut-être utile cette description technique des tableaux.

En PHP, les tableaux sont créés à l’aide de la fonction array(). Vous pouvez rencontrer des tableaux en travaillant sur des thèmes ou des extensions WordPress ou simplement en regardant le code cœur de WordPress.

Trois types peuvent être créés en PHP :

  • Lestableaux indexés utilisent des clés numériques pour accéder aux valeurs.
  • Lestableaux associatifs utilisent des clés de texte ou de chaîne pour accéder aux valeurs.
  • Lestableaux multidimensionnels contiennent plus d’un tableau.

De nombreux tableaux sont utilisés pour parcourir en boucle un ensemble de données et effectuer une opération sur chaque valeur.

Par exemple, si vous avez trois fruits, vous pouvez stocker chacun d’entre eux dans une variable distincte :

$fruit1 = "apple";
$fruit2 = "orange";
$fruit3 = "banana";

Cela peut rapidement devenir très salissant.

Une meilleure solution consisterait à les placer dans un tableau comme celui-ci :

	$fruit = array("apple", "orange", "banana");

Vous pouvez maintenant utiliser les fonctions de tableau intégrées pour effectuer des opérations sur les données. Par exemple, vous pouvez utiliser les fonctions de tableau intégrées pour effectuer des opérations sur les données :

  • $fruit[0] serait égal à 'apple' (les tableaux commencent à zéro)
  • $fruit[1] serait égal à 'orange'
  • $fruit[2] serait égal à 'banana'
  • count() vous indique le nombre d’éléments de votre tableau

Exemple de tableau dans WordPress

Vous aimeriez peut-être voir un extrait de code pour WordPress qui utilise un tableau.

Dans le code ci-dessous, la variable $args est un tableau qui stocke un certain nombre d’arguments. Ceux-ci sont ensuite passés dans la fonction wp_list_categories ultérieurement :

<?php
$args = array(
  'taxonomy'     => 'category',
  'orderby'      => 'name',
  'show_count'   => 0,
  'pad_counts'   => 0,
  'hierarchical' => 1,
  'title_li'     => 'Categories'
);
?>
 
<ul>
<?php wp_list_categories( $args ); ?>
</ul>

Nous espérons que cet article vous a aidé à en savoir plus sur les tableaux dans WordPress. Vous pouvez également consulter notre liste de lectures complémentaires ci-dessous pour des articles liés à des astuces, des trucs et des idées utiles sur WordPress.

Si vous avez aimé cet article, veuillez alors vous abonner à notre chaîne YouTube pour obtenir des tutoriels vidéo sur WordPress. Vous pouvez également nous trouver sur Twitter et Facebook.

Lectures complémentaires

Avatar

Editorial Staff at WPBeginner is a team of WordPress experts led by Syed Balkhi with over 16 years of experience in WordPress, Web Hosting, eCommerce, SEO, and Marketing. Started in 2009, WPBeginner is now the largest free WordPress resource site in the industry and is often referred to as the Wikipedia for WordPress.

L'ultime WordPress Toolkit

Accédez GRATUITEMENT à notre boîte à outils - une collection de produits et de ressources liés à WordPress que tous les professionnels devraient avoir !